Starting from June 1, 2014, the second part of Russia's new anti smoking legislation comes into force: a full ban on smoking at bars, restaurants, long-distance trains, dormitories, and hotels. The new law also bans distance selling of cigarettes and cigarette displays. Kiosks are no longer allowed to sell cigarettes.
